Painting Description
The "Portrait of Catherine II of Russia" by Dmitry Levitzky is a notable work of art that captures the likeness of Catherine the Great, the Empress of Russia from 1762 until 1796. Dmitry Levitzky, a prominent Russian portraitist of the 18th century, was renowned for his ability to convey the character and status of his subjects through his paintings. This particular portrait is one of several that Levitzky created of the Empress, reflecting her powerful and enlightened rule.
Catherine II is depicted with a regal and composed demeanor, embodying the ideals of the Enlightenment that she championed during her reign. The portrait showcases her in luxurious attire, often adorned with symbols of her imperial authority, such as a crown or scepter, though specific details may vary across different versions of her portraits by Levitzky. The background and setting typically emphasize her status and the grandeur of the Russian court.
Levitzky's technique in this portrait is characterized by meticulous attention to detail and a refined use of color, which highlights the textures of the fabrics and the subtle expressions of the Empress. His work is celebrated for its elegance and the psychological depth with which he portrayed his subjects, offering insight into their personalities and the era in which they lived.
This portrait not only serves as a visual representation of Catherine the Great but also as a historical document that reflects the cultural and political climate of 18th-century Russia. Levitzky's portraits of Catherine are considered significant contributions to Russian art, capturing the essence of one of the most influential figures in Russian history.
The painting is part of the collection of the State Russian Museum in St. Petersburg, where it continues to be admired by visitors and art historians alike for its artistic merit and historical significance.
